diff --git a/frontend/src/AppRoutes.tsx b/frontend/src/AppRoutes.tsx index a8b5e2bcb..9570877ba 100644 --- a/frontend/src/AppRoutes.tsx +++ b/frontend/src/AppRoutes.tsx @@ -48,6 +48,7 @@ import { SamfOutlet } from './Components/SamfOutlet'; import { SultenOutlet } from './Components/SultenOutlet'; import { VenuePage } from './Pages/VenuePage'; import { AdminLayout } from './PagesAdmin/AdminLayout/AdminLayout'; +import { InterviewNotesPage } from './PagesAdmin/InterviewNotesAdminPage'; import { RecruitmentFormAdminPage } from './PagesAdmin/RecruitmentFormAdminPage'; import { RecruitmentPositionOverviewPage } from './PagesAdmin/RecruitmentPositionOverviewPage/RecruitmentPositionOverviewPage'; import { SaksdokumentAdminPage } from './PagesAdmin/SaksdokumentAdminPage'; @@ -186,6 +187,10 @@ export function AppRoutes() { path={ROUTES.frontend.admin_recruitment_users_without_interview} element={} /> + } + /> {/* TODO ADD PERMISSIONS */} +
+ + + +
+ + ); +} diff --git a/frontend/src/PagesAdmin/InterviewNotesAdminPage/index.ts b/frontend/src/PagesAdmin/InterviewNotesAdminPage/index.ts new file mode 100644 index 000000000..47e8245a0 --- /dev/null +++ b/frontend/src/PagesAdmin/InterviewNotesAdminPage/index.ts @@ -0,0 +1 @@ +export { InterviewNotesPage } from './InterviewNotesAdminPage'; diff --git a/frontend/src/PagesAdmin/index.ts b/frontend/src/PagesAdmin/index.ts index 9fba79c85..62c69c360 100644 --- a/frontend/src/PagesAdmin/index.ts +++ b/frontend/src/PagesAdmin/index.ts @@ -9,6 +9,7 @@ export { ImageAdminPage } from './ImageAdminPage'; export { ImageFormAdminPage } from './ImageFormAdminPage'; export { InformationAdminPage } from './InformationAdminPage'; export { InformationFormAdminPage } from './InformationFormAdminPage'; +export { InterviewNotesPage } from './InterviewNotesAdminPage'; export { OpeningHoursAdminPage } from './OpeningHoursAdminPage'; export { RecruitmentAdminPage } from './RecruitmentAdminPage'; export { RecruitmentGangAdminPage } from './RecruitmentGangAdminPage'; diff --git a/frontend/src/i18n/constants.ts b/frontend/src/i18n/constants.ts index 5859295d3..eeefc0e72 100644 --- a/frontend/src/i18n/constants.ts +++ b/frontend/src/i18n/constants.ts @@ -157,6 +157,7 @@ export const KEY = { recruitment_applicant: 'recruitment_applicant', recruitment_interview_time: 'recruitment_interview_time', recruitment_interview_location: 'recruitment_interview_location', + recruitment_interview_notes: 'recruitment_interview_notes', recruitment_priority: 'recruitment_priority', recruitment_recruiter_priority: 'recruitment_recruiter_priority', recruitment_recruiter_status: 'recruitment_recruiter_status', diff --git a/frontend/src/i18n/translations.ts b/frontend/src/i18n/translations.ts index 37ae53eee..287ee5d94 100644 --- a/frontend/src/i18n/translations.ts +++ b/frontend/src/i18n/translations.ts @@ -145,6 +145,7 @@ export const nb: Record = { [KEY.recruitment_applicant]: 'Søker', [KEY.recruitment_interview_time]: 'Intervjutid', [KEY.recruitment_interview_location]: 'Intervjusted', + [KEY.recruitment_interview_notes]: 'Intervju notater', [KEY.recruitment_priority]: 'Søkers prioritet', [KEY.recruitment_recruiter_priority]: 'Prioritet', [KEY.recruitment_recruiter_status]: 'Status', @@ -369,6 +370,7 @@ export const en: Record = { [KEY.recruitment_applicant]: 'Applicant', [KEY.recruitment_interview_time]: 'Intervjutid', [KEY.recruitment_interview_location]: 'Intervjusted', + [KEY.recruitment_interview_notes]: 'Interview notes', [KEY.recruitment_priority]: 'Søkers prioritet', [KEY.recruitment_recruiter_priority]: 'Prioritet', [KEY.recruitment_recruiter_status]: 'Status', diff --git a/frontend/src/routes/frontend.ts b/frontend/src/routes/frontend.ts index 17064f559..6a573dfdb 100644 --- a/frontend/src/routes/frontend.ts +++ b/frontend/src/routes/frontend.ts @@ -66,6 +66,8 @@ export const ROUTES_FRONTEND = { admin_recruitment_gang_position_edit: '/control-panel/recruitment/:recruitmentId/gang/:gangId/edit/:positionId', admin_recruitment_gang_position_applicants_overview: '/control-panel/recruitment/:recruitmentId/gang/:gangId/position/:positionId', + admin_recruitment_gang_position_applicants_interview_notes: + '/control-panel/recruitment/:recruitmentId/gang/:gangId/position/:positionId/notesId', //fix when backend is done // ==================== // // Development // // ==================== //